Siemens Solar Panels Power EPA Roadway Lighting

December 26, 2001 by Jeff Shepard

Siemens Solar Industries LP (Camarillo, CA) announced that its panels are powering the roadway lighting to the headquarter campus of the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A, Research Triangle Park, NC). The complete solar-powered lighting systems were manufactured by Solar Electric Power Co. Ltd. (SEPCO, UK).

"We chose Siemens Solar panels because they've proven themselves in the field - in some of the harshest climates on the planet - for decades,” stated Steven Robbins, president of SEPCO.

EPA Project Manager Chris Long commented, “We're extremely pleased with the installation. We're committed to using cost-effective technologies that reduce our air pollution impact, and this project speaks volumes about our commitment to clean, renewable energy.”
